A fresh wave of creativity has hit the Destiny 2 community, spurred by a recent fashion showcase centered around a reimagined Dr. Doom. As players flaunt their designs, laughter and admiration echo across forums, igniting discussions on character interpretation and costume innovation.
With players actively sharing their interpretations, they challenge the status quo of character design. The title has become synonymous with ambitious fashion in gaming, and itโs clear that this remix of a classic villain struck a chord.

Like many online fandoms, this community values contributions. In light of that, keep these in mind:
Detail Your Gear: Listing your gear and shaders is recommended by many. While not mandatory, it helps others replicate or build upon your designs.
Engage Lightly: Humor and playful banter create a welcoming forum atmosphere.
Be Open to Feedback: Encouragement often leads to new ideas and perspectives.
